Fact Checks (2)
"Roger Ailes publicly supported Fox News employees against the Obama administration"
True

Roger Ailes issued a companywide memo around May 23-24, 2013, explicitly defending Fox News reporters including James Rosen, stating the Obama administration was attempting to 'intimidate Fox News and its employees' and calling it a 'climate of press intimidation, unseen since the McCarthy era.'

"Obama administration intimidated Fox News reporters"
Half True

The DOJ did name Fox News reporter James Rosen as a criminal co-conspirator and conducted surveillance of his emails and State Department visits in a classified leak probe — actions widely criticized by press freedom organizations and journalism groups across the political spectrum. Attorney General Holder personally signed the warrant. Whether this constitutes 'intimidation' as a characterization is contested; the actions were legally procedural (if widely condemned) rather than extra-legal threats. 'Intimidation' was Ailes' own framing, adopted here wholesale.
